Impairment of Collateral Sample Clauses

Impairment of Collateral. Not use any material portion of the Collateral, or permit the same to be used, for any unlawful purpose, in any manner that is reasonably likely to materially adversely impair the value or usefulness of the Collateral, or in any manner inconsistent with the provisions or requirements of any policy of insurance thereon nor affix or install any accessories, equipment, or device on the Collateral or on any component thereof if such addition will materially impair the original intended function or use of the Collateral or such component.

Impairment of Collateral. There shall occur any injury or damage to all or any part of the Collateral or all or any part of the Collateral shall be lost, stolen or destroyed.
Impairment of Collateral. There shall occur any injury or damage to all or any part of the Collateral or all or any part of the Collateral shall be lost, stolen or destroyed, which changes cause the Collateral, in the sole and absolute judgement of the Bank, to become unacceptable as to character and value.
Impairment of Collateral. Not use any of the Collateral, or permit the same to be used, for any unlawful purpose, in any manner that is reasonably likely to adversely impair the value or usefulness of the Collateral, or in any manner inconsistent with the provisions or requirements of any policy of insurance thereon nor affix or install any accessories, equipment, or device on the Collateral or on any component thereof if such addition will impair the original intended function or use of the Collateral or such component.
Impairment of Collateral. Any security interest purported to be created by any Collateral Document shall cease to be, or shall be asserted by any Group Company not to be, a valid, perfected, Lien (except as otherwise expressly provided in such Collateral Document) in the securities, assets or properties covered thereby, other than in respect of assets and properties which, individually and in the aggregate, are not material to the Group Companies taken as a whole or in respect of which the failure of the security interests in respect thereof to be valid, perfected first priority security interests will not in the reasonable judgment of the Collateral Agent have a Material Adverse Effect on the rights and benefits of the Lenders under the Loan Documents taken as a whole.
Impairment of Collateral. Any security interest purported to be created by any Collateral Document shall cease to be, or shall be asserted by any Andersons Party not to be, a valid, perfected, first-priority (except as otherwise expressly provided in such Collateral Document) security interest in the securities, assets or properties covered thereby.
Impairment of Collateral. Lenders or Agent may, in their sole discretion, release any Collateral securing the Obligations or release any party liable therefor. The defenses of impairment of collateral and impairment of recourse and any requirement of diligence in collecting the Obligations are hereby waived.

Impairment of Collateral. Subject to the rights of the holders of any senior Liens and Section 14.07, the Issuer shall not, and shall not permit Intermediate Holdings or any of the Restricted Subsidiaries to, take or knowingly or negligently omit to take, any action which action or omission would or could reasonably be expected to have the result of materially impairing the security interest with respect to the Collateral for the benefit of the Trustee and the Holders, unless such action or failure to take action is otherwise permitted by this Indenture, the Intercreditor Agreements or the Collateral Documents.

Impairment of Collateral. No Grantor shall use any of the Collateral, or permit the same to be used, (i) for any unlawful purpose, (ii) in any manner that is reasonably likely, individually or in the aggregate, to materially adversely impair the value or usefulness of the Collateral, or (iii) in any manner inconsistent with the provisions or requirements of any policy of insurance thereon.
